This example shows how to create a sheet metal gusset feature.
//
----------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Preconditions:
// 1. Open
public_documents\samples\tutorial\api\SMGussetAPI.sldprt.
// 2. Open an Immediate
window.
//
// Postconditions:
// 1. Inserts Sheet
Metal Gusset1.
// 2. Press F5 and
observe the modified gusset.
// 3. Inspect the
Immediate window for the flatten settings of the gusset.
// 4. Expand
Flat-Pattern in the FeatureManager design tree, right-click
//
Flat-Pattern(1), and click Unsuppress.
// 5. Observe the center
mark and profile of the gusset in its
//
flattened state.
//
// NOTE: Because the
model is used elsewhere, do not save changes.
//
---------------------------------------------------------------------------
